Join Us for a Tuesday Night Ride

It’s that time of the week – Tuesday! The Mason Tuesday Night Ride is mid-Michigan’s best training ride for local and visiting mass start cyclists that emphasizes both high average speeds and race finishing skills.

The Tuesday Night Ride is a high quality road bicycle training ride around Mason, Michigan. Cyclists will ride along a 40-mile loop, consisting of flat and rolling terrain. The ride is a group pace line effort to simulate race speeds, which culminates in five sprints throughout the loop. After each sprint we regroup, recover briefly while spinning and repeat the fun. The benefit to racers is the chance to learn and practice high average speeds and race finishing skills. Speeds average 22-24 mph with lows of 16 mph and highs of 38 mph.
